Natural Maya Mountain Ceremonial Cacao 100g is made from heirloom beans grown by indigenous Mopan and Q’eqchi’ Maya family farmers in the Maya Mountain region of Belize. No blends, no additives — just the authentic character of the bean itself.
What makes this ceremonial grade cacao different
This is 100% pure organic cacao, stone-ground in small batches with attention to the raw material. Because only the beans are used, you taste the true flavour of the heirloom variety: sweet fruit notes, a creamy body and a subtle nutty finish. These aromatics develop naturally through the growing conditions, fermentation and traditional processing in Belize. Made for simple daily rituals
The convenient 100g disc breaks into ten 10g pieces, giving you full control over how much you use each time. Warm your water, (plant-based) milk or tea on low heat, add your chosen amount and whisk or blend until smooth and creamy. The cacao is unsweetened and contains only natural sugars, so you can add spices or sweeteners to taste. It suits quiet mornings, moments of reflection or a calm pause in the afternoon.
